2 Channel, 500 ksps to 1 Msps, 10-Bit A/D Converter 8-VSSOP -40 to 85

Technical Data
Technology CMOS
Width (mm) 3
Length (mm) 3
JESD-30 Code S-PDSO-G8
Package Code TSSOP
Output Format SERIAL
Package Shape SQUARE
Package Style (Meter) SMALL OUTLINE, THIN PROFILE, SHRINK PITCH
Surface Mount YES
Terminal Form GULL WING
Converter Type ADC, SUCCESSIVE APPROXIMATION
J-STD-609 Code e3
Number of Bits 10
Output Bit Code BINARY
Terminal Finish Matte Tin (Sn)
DLA Qualification Not Qualified
Sample Rate (MHz) 1
Temperature Grade INDUSTRIAL
Terminal Position DUAL
Number of Functions 1
Number of Terminals 8
Terminal Pitch (mm) 0.65
Package Body Material PLASTIC/EPOXY
Seated Height-Max (mm) 1.1
Supply Voltage-Min (V) 2.7
Supply Voltage-Nom (V) 3
Supply Current-Max (mA) 2.7
Conversion Time-Max (us) 1.625
Package Equivalence Code TSSOP8,.19
Moisture Sensitivity Level 1
Analog Input Voltage-Max (V) 5.25
Analog Input Voltage-Min (V) 0
Linearity Error-Max (EL) (%) 0.0684
Number of Analog In Channels 2
Peak Reflow Temperature (Cel) 260
Sample-and-Hold/Track-and-Hold TRACK
Operating Temperature-Max (Cel) 85
Operating Temperature-Min (Cel) -40
Time@Peak Reflow Temperature-Max (s) 30
Configuration MUX-S/H-ADC
